Both easements and right-of-ways have limitations and do not offer unconfined access to everyone for whatever they desire. This can be either walking or with lorries, and it can be made use of for a range of functions, such as accessing a back garden, a public path or a public roadway. A right-of-way can be granted to a private or to the general public, and it can be limited to details times or functions. An easement is a right that individual needs to make use of one more person's land for a specific function. Easements can be provided for a range of purposes, such as for access to energies, for water drainage or for the upkeep of a common feature like a wall surface or fencing.

What is a continuous right of way in the Philippines?

A "" continuous access"" grants somebody the lawful authority to travel through one more''s building indefinitely, usually because their property is landlocked and lacks sufficient accessibility to a public roadway.
